I don't care about e ink or about this phone either, since there's not a single mention of Open Source. I care about dumbphones, a dumbphone has advantages that a smart phone will never have:

  • Excellent battery life.
  • Smaller attack surface.
  • Great for tech-detox.
  • Great for minimalists.
  • Great for seniors.

And this new minimal phone shows that there is demand for something closer to what we call a 'dumb phone', I wish that Pine would create their own dumb phone.
